mailarchive of the ptxdist mailing list
 help / color / mirror / Atom feed
From: Ladislav Michl <ladis@linux-mips.org>
To: ptxdist@pengutronix.de
Subject: [ptxdist] [PATCH 0/2] add scons conf tool and let gpsd to use it
Date: Fri, 25 Oct 2019 09:33:26 +0200	[thread overview]
Message-ID: <20191025073326.GB26830@lenoch> (raw)

Hi there,

this is unfortunatelly kind of duplicate work done previously by
Denis OSTERLAND. This seems to be pretty common, as there's another
patch by Fabian Godehardt sent by Sascha Hauer both being unaware
of Denis' work. I found those too late (the second one while writing
this cover letter), so I decided to continue with my a bit different
approach. Also, both seem to have the same python binding problem :)

Please note, that for some reason gpsd's SConstruct changes compiler
while building python bindings - see line 1636 and bellow. Therefore
python bindings is currently defunct. If anyone figure out how to fix
that (and what SCons authors had in mind implementing yet another build
system) I would be very happy.

This is still work in progress [*], released early to make Alexander
Dahl happy as he expressed interrest in gpsd update :)

	ladis

[*] it basically means it is good enough for my purposes, although it
would deserve better init system integration, installing udev rules,
fixed python, etc...

Ladislav Michl (2):
  add scons conf tool
  gpsd: version bump 2.39 -> 3.19

 ...ix-core-compiling-with-nmea-disabled.patch |  29 ---
 ...kage-if-some-drivers-are-not-enabled.patch |  48 -----
 .../0003-fix-a-simple-compile-error.patch     |  28 ---
 patches/gpsd-2.39/0004-Fix-autotool-bug.patch |  53 -----
 ...-on-AM_PATH_PYTHON-to-work-propperly.patch | 104 ---------
 .../gpsd-2.39/0006-fix-parallel-build.patch   |  38 ----
 patches/gpsd-2.39/autogen.sh                  |   4 -
 patches/gpsd-2.39/series                      |   9 -
 patches/gpsd-3.19/0001-fix-ncurses.patch      |  11 +
 patches/gpsd-3.19/series                      |   1 +
 rules/gpsd.in                                 | 110 ++++++----
 rules/gpsd.make                               | 203 +++++++++++-------
 scripts/lib/ptxd_make_world_common.sh         |   4 +-
 scripts/lib/ptxd_make_world_compile.sh        |   8 +
 scripts/lib/ptxd_make_world_install.sh        |  10 +
 scripts/lib/ptxd_make_world_prepare.sh        |   7 +-
 16 files changed, 235 insertions(+), 432 deletions(-)
 delete mode 100644 patches/gpsd-2.39/0001-fix-core-compiling-with-nmea-disabled.patch
 delete mode 100644 patches/gpsd-2.39/0002-fix-link-breakage-if-some-drivers-are-not-enabled.patch
 delete mode 100644 patches/gpsd-2.39/0003-fix-a-simple-compile-error.patch
 delete mode 100644 patches/gpsd-2.39/0004-Fix-autotool-bug.patch
 delete mode 100644 patches/gpsd-2.39/0005-just-rely-on-AM_PATH_PYTHON-to-work-propperly.patch
 delete mode 100644 patches/gpsd-2.39/0006-fix-parallel-build.patch
 delete mode 100755 patches/gpsd-2.39/autogen.sh
 delete mode 100644 patches/gpsd-2.39/series
 create mode 100644 patches/gpsd-3.19/0001-fix-ncurses.patch
 create mode 100644 patches/gpsd-3.19/series

-- 
2.24.0.rc0


_______________________________________________
ptxdist mailing list
ptxdist@pengutronix.de

             reply	other threads:[~2019-10-25  7:33 UTC|newest]

Thread overview: 17+ messages / expand[flat|nested]  mbox.gz  Atom feed  top
2019-10-25  7:33 Ladislav Michl [this message]
2019-10-25  7:34 ` [ptxdist] [PATCH 1/2] add scons conf tool Ladislav Michl
2019-10-25  7:55   ` Michael Olbrich
2019-10-25 23:09     ` Ladislav Michl
2019-10-27  6:30       ` Michael Olbrich
2019-11-15 19:19         ` Ladislav Michl
2019-11-16 10:08           ` Michael Olbrich
2019-11-18 21:15             ` Ladislav Michl
2019-10-25  7:35 ` [ptxdist] [PATCH 2/2] gpsd: version bump 2.39 -> 3.19 Ladislav Michl
2019-10-25  8:16   ` Michael Olbrich
2019-10-25 13:17     ` [ptxdist] [PATCH v2] " Ladislav Michl
2019-10-25 13:38       ` Michael Olbrich
2019-10-25 13:58         ` Ladislav Michl
2019-10-25 23:13         ` [ptxdist] [PATCH v3] " Ladislav Michl
2019-10-27  6:22           ` Michael Olbrich
2019-10-27 16:25           ` Michael Olbrich
2019-10-27 22:29             ` Ladislav Michl

Reply instructions:

You may reply publicly to this message via plain-text email
using any one of the following methods:

* Save the following mbox file, import it into your mail client,
  and reply-to-all from there: mbox

  Avoid top-posting and favor interleaved quoting:
  https://en.wikipedia.org/wiki/Posting_style#Interleaved_style

* Reply using the --to, --cc, and --in-reply-to
  switches of git-send-email(1):

  git send-email \
    --in-reply-to=20191025073326.GB26830@lenoch \
    --to=ladis@linux-mips.org \
    --cc=ptxdist@pengutronix.de \
    /path/to/YOUR_REPLY

  https://kernel.org/pub/software/scm/git/docs/git-send-email.html

* If your mail client supports setting the In-Reply-To header
  via mailto: links, try the mailto: link
Be sure your reply has a Subject: header at the top and a blank line before the message body.
This is a public inbox, see mirroring instructions
for how to clone and mirror all data and code used for this inbox